XML 106 R91.htm IDEA: XBRL DOCUMENT v3.24.0.1
Debt (Narrative) (Details)
1 Months Ended 12 Months Ended
Jan. 31, 2023
Dec. 31, 2023
USD ($)
Dec. 31, 2022
USD ($)
Dec. 31, 2021
USD ($)
Mar. 31, 2025
Jun. 30, 2024
Debt Instrument [Line Items]            
Gain on extinguishment of debt   $ 3,064,000 $ (4,993,000) $ (56,209,000)    
Interest rate swaps            
Debt Instrument [Line Items]            
Total notional amount of outstanding contracts   200,000,000        
Fixed interest rate 0.585%          
Secured Overnight Financing Rate (SOFR) | Interest rate swaps            
Debt Instrument [Line Items]            
Basis spread on variable rate 0.10%          
Line of credit | Revolving Credit Facility            
Debt Instrument [Line Items]            
Maximum borrowing capacity   $ 500,000,000        
Leverage ratio, maximum   4.25        
Interest coverage ratio, minimum   1.75        
Borrowings under facility   $ 0        
Line of credit | Revolving Credit Facility | Forecast            
Debt Instrument [Line Items]            
Leverage ratio, maximum           4.0
Interest coverage ratio, minimum         2.0  
Notes due March 2028 | Notes due            
Debt Instrument [Line Items]            
Face amount   $ 275,000,000        
Interest rate   12.20%        
Notes due March 2028 | Notes due | Secured Overnight Financing Rate (SOFR)            
Debt Instrument [Line Items]            
Basis spread on variable rate   6.90%        
Discount rate   3.00%        
Term loan due March 2026 | Notes due            
Debt Instrument [Line Items]            
Debt redeemed   $ 30,000,000        
Interest rate   7.70%        
Term loan due March 2026 | Notes due | Secured Overnight Financing Rate (SOFR)            
Debt Instrument [Line Items]            
Basis spread on variable rate   2.25%        
Notes due 2024 and 2027 | Notes due            
Debt Instrument [Line Items]            
Purchase of debt   $ 39,000,000        
Gain on extinguishment of debt   3,000,000        
Term loan due 2026 and Term loan due 2028 | Notes due            
Debt Instrument [Line Items]            
Debt redeemed   $ 42,000,000        
Term loan due March 2028 | Notes due            
Debt Instrument [Line Items]            
Interest rate   9.50%        
Term loan due March 2028 | Notes due | Secured Overnight Financing Rate (SOFR)            
Debt Instrument [Line Items]            
Basis spread on variable rate   4.00%